Output 68e6d66bab2ea5836142be4d2debf8a67f4f6d84e0e5a5f081f60a86bcdaaee3:0

value
2809822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e78a6fa222faee96c1d18e5d012da0179fa8585c OP_EQUAL
address
3NoHrZcqw355uAmPwTiyH3WneVeSbZUmj6
transaction
68e6d66bab2ea5836142be4d2debf8a67f4f6d84e0e5a5f081f60a86bcdaaee3
spent
true